Google loses key appeal against €2.4 billion EU shopping antitrust case

The EU’s second-most senior court, the General Court, has upheld a 2017 ruling by the European Commission which found that Google broke antitrust law in how it promoted its shopping comparison service and demoted rivals. via Technology and News Today

NASA pushes back crewed moon landing to 2025

NASA has officially adjusted its timeline for the Artemis III mission and won’t be landing on the Moon in 2024. The agency is now aiming to land the first woman and next American man on the lunar surface in 2025 at the earliest, NASA administrator Bill Nelson has announced. via Technology and News Today